]> nv-tegra.nvidia Code Review - linux-2.6.git/blobdiff - arch/sh/include/cpu-sh3/cpu/dac.h
sh: Reworked SH7780 PCI initialization.
[linux-2.6.git] / arch / sh / include / cpu-sh3 / cpu / dac.h
index 05fda8316ebcaf577155965f1d9fc55234c880e4..98f1d15f0ab5e3a0a0b988bd634d3ab121ab4694 100644 (file)
 static __inline__ void sh_dac_enable(int channel)
 {
        unsigned char v;
-       v = ctrl_inb(DACR);
+       v = __raw_readb(DACR);
        if(channel) v |= DACR_DAOE1;
        else v |= DACR_DAOE0;
-       ctrl_outb(v,DACR);
+       __raw_writeb(v,DACR);
 }
 
 static __inline__ void sh_dac_disable(int channel)
 {
        unsigned char v;
-       v = ctrl_inb(DACR);
+       v = __raw_readb(DACR);
        if(channel) v &= ~DACR_DAOE1;
        else v &= ~DACR_DAOE0;
-       ctrl_outb(v,DACR);
+       __raw_writeb(v,DACR);
 }
 
 static __inline__ void sh_dac_output(u8 value, int channel)
 {
-       if(channel) ctrl_outb(value,DADR1);
-       else ctrl_outb(value,DADR0);
+       if(channel) __raw_writeb(value,DADR1);
+       else __raw_writeb(value,DADR0);
 }
 
 #endif /* __ASM_CPU_SH3_DAC_H */